> Cache up to 4 kiB entries. 4 kiB is the default block size on ext4, yet
> the underlying block layer devices usually report support for 512B . In
> most cases, the 512B support is emulated (ie. SD cards, SSDs, USB sticks
> etc.) and the real block size of those devices is much bigger.
> 
> To avoid performance degradation with such devices and FS setup, bump
> the maximum cache entry size to 4 kiB.
